Determing build date from VIN no.???
 
How would you determine a build date from a VIN no.?

From memory, the Porsche model years run from around Sep to Aug. Thus, a 1973 "Model" car could have actually been built/delivered in late 72.

Anyone have this information? It is relevant for classing a race car based on "year of manufacture"
